Syracuse native Elliot Sneider, who just earned his doctorate at Arizona State, will perform in the 2nd performance of his City Colors/City Lights, a 2014 work. This will be the first time the work is accompanied by video, created by Syracuse videographer Courtney Rile. Completing the program is Poulenc’s much-loved Clarinet Sonata, the last work he wrote, and a work for 2 pianos by Michael Boyman, the NY Federation of Music Clubs Israel winner in 2014. Both Ms. Vehar & Mr. Boyman will attend.
